297 resultados para Co-processors


Relevância:

20.00% 20.00%

Publicador:

Resumo:

In this paper, an approach to enhance the Extra High Voltage (EHV) Transmission system distance protection is presented. The scheme depends on the apparent impedance seen by the distance relay during the disturbance. In a distance relay,the impedance seen at the relay location is calculated from the fundamental frequency component of the voltage and current signals. Support Vector Machines (SVMs) are a new learning-byexample are employed in discriminating zone settings (Zone-1,Zone-2 and Zone-3) using the signals to be used by the relay.Studies on 265-bus system, an equivalent of practical Indian Western grid are presented for illustrating the proposed scheme.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Cobalt and iron nanoparticles are doped in carbon nanotube (CNT)/polymer matrix composites and studied for strain and magnetic field sensing properties. Characterization of these samples is done for various volume fractions of each constituent (Co and Fe nanoparticles and CNTs) and also for cases when only either of the metallic components is present. The relation between the magnetic field and polarization-induced strain are exploited. The electronic bandgap change in the CNTs is obtained by a simplified tight-binding formulation in terms of strain and magnetic field. A nonlinear constitutive model of glassy polymer is employed to account for (1) electric bias field dependent softening/hardening (2) CNT orientations as a statistical ensemble and (3) CNT volume fraction. An effective medium theory is then employed where the CNTs and nanoparticles are treated as inclusions. The intensity of the applied magnetic field is read indirectly as the change in resistance of the sample. Very small magnetic fields can be detected using this technique since the resistance is highly sensitive to strain. Its sensitivity due to the CNT volume fraction is also discussed. The advantage of this sensor lies in the fact that it can be molded into desirable shape and can be used in fabrication of embedded sensors where the material can detect external magnetic fields on its own. Besides, the stress-controlled hysteresis of the sample can be used in designing memory devices. These composites have potential for use in magnetic encoders, which are made of a magnetic field sensor and a barcode.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Digest caches have been proposed as an effective method tospeed up packet classification in network processors. In this paper, weshow that the presence of a large number of small flows and a few largeflows in the Internet has an adverse impact on the performance of thesedigest caches. In the Internet, a few large flows transfer a majority ofthe packets whereas the contribution of several small flows to the totalnumber of packets transferred is small. In such a scenario, the LRUcache replacement policy, which gives maximum priority to the mostrecently accessed digest, tends to evict digests belonging to the few largeflows. We propose a new cache management algorithm called SaturatingPriority (SP) which aims at improving the performance of digest cachesin network processors by exploiting the disparity between the number offlows and the number of packets transferred. Our experimental resultsdemonstrate that SP performs better than the widely used LRU cachereplacement policy in size constrained caches. Further, we characterizethe misses experienced by flow identifiers in digest caches.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

MATLAB is an array language, initially popular for rapid prototyping, but is now being increasingly used to develop production code for numerical and scientific applications. Typical MATLAB programs have abundant data parallelism. These programs also have control flow dominated scalar regions that have an impact on the program's execution time. Today's computer systems have tremendous computing power in the form of traditional CPU cores and throughput oriented accelerators such as graphics processing units(GPUs). Thus, an approach that maps the control flow dominated regions to the CPU and the data parallel regions to the GPU can significantly improve program performance. In this paper, we present the design and implementation of MEGHA, a compiler that automatically compiles MATLAB programs to enable synergistic execution on heterogeneous processors. Our solution is fully automated and does not require programmer input for identifying data parallel regions. We propose a set of compiler optimizations tailored for MATLAB. Our compiler identifies data parallel regions of the program and composes them into kernels. The problem of combining statements into kernels is formulated as a constrained graph clustering problem. Heuristics are presented to map identified kernels to either the CPU or GPU so that kernel execution on the CPU and the GPU happens synergistically and the amount of data transfer needed is minimized. In order to ensure required data movement for dependencies across basic blocks, we propose a data flow analysis and edge splitting strategy. Thus our compiler automatically handles composition of kernels, mapping of kernels to CPU and GPU, scheduling and insertion of required data transfer. The proposed compiler was implemented and experimental evaluation using a set of MATLAB benchmarks shows that our approach achieves a geometric mean speedup of 19.8X for data parallel benchmarks over native execution of MATLAB.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Network processors today consist of multiple parallel processors (micro engines) with support for multiple threads to exploit packet level parallelism inherent in network workloads. With such concurrency, packet ordering at the output of the network processor cannot be guaranteed. This paper studies the effect of concurrency in network processors on packet ordering. We use a validated Petri net model of a commercial network processor, Intel IXP 2400, to determine the extent of packet reordering for IPv4 forwarding application. Our study indicates that in addition to the parallel processing in the network processor, the allocation scheme for the transmit buffer also adversely impacts packet ordering. In particular, our results reveal that these packet reordering results in a packet retransmission rate of up to 61%. We explore different transmit buffer allocation schemes namely, contiguous, strided, local, and global which reduces the packet retransmission to 24%. We propose an alternative scheme, packet sort, which guarantees complete packet ordering while achieving a throughput of 2.5 Gbps. Further, packet sort outperforms the in-built packet ordering schemes in the IXP processor by up to 35%.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Distributed space time coding for wireless relay networks where the source, the destination and the relays have multiple antennas have been studied by Jing and Hassibi. In this set up, the transmit and the receive signals at different antennas of the same relay are processed and designed independently, even though the antennas are colocated. In this paper, a wireless relay network with single antenna at the source and the destination and two antennas at each of the R relays is considered. In the first phase of the two-phase transmission model, a T -length complex vector is transmitted from the source to all the relays. At each relay, the inphase and quadrature component vectors of the received complex vectors at the two antennas are interleaved before processing them. After processing, in the second phase, a T x 2R matrix codeword is transmitted to the destination. The collection of all such codewords is called Co-ordinate interleaved distributed space-time code (CIDSTC). Compared to the scheme proposed by Jing-Hassibi, for T ges AR, it is shown that while both the schemes give the same asymptotic diversity gain, the CIDSTC scheme gives additional asymptotic coding gain as well and that too at the cost of negligible increase in the processing complexity at the relays.

Relevância:

20.00% 20.00%

Publicador:

Resumo:

Poly(acrylic acid-co-sodium acrylate-co-acrylamide) superabsorbent polymers (SAPs) cross-linked with ethylene glycol dimethacrylate (EGDMA) were synthesized by inverse suspension polymerization. The SAPs were swollen in DI water, and it was found that the equilibrium swelling capacities varied with the acrylamide content. The SAPs were subjected to reversible swelling/deswelling cycles in DI water and aqueous NaCl solution, respectively. The effect of the addition of an electrolyte on the swelling of the SAP was explored. The equilibrium swelling capacity of the SAPs was found to decrease with increasing concentration of added electrolyte in the swelling medium. The effect of the particle size of the dry SAPs on the swelling properties was also investigated. A first order model was used to describe the kinetics of swelling/deswelling, and the equilibrium swelling capacity, limiting swelling capacity, and swelling/deswelling rate coefficients were determined.